Job Summary

RBC Shared Services Malaysia is a processing center of operational excellence supporting multiple RBC businesses in countries across various time zones. Malaysia is one of several operational processing centers within RBC supporting a variety of businesses and Functions including Wealth Management, Capital Markets, I&TS, GRM, and Finance. The entity utilizes a Global Operating Model to maximize efficiencies across times zones and supports various shifts to ensure ongoing support across time zones. The objectives for Malaysia are to enhance the scalability of RBC’s global operations, improve service quality via our ‘centers of excellence’ and to implement / leverage standard processes.

As a Senior Recruiter, you will manage the end-to-end recruitment process for all assigned business group and be responsible for the Talent Attraction Strategy in collaboration with Senior Manager, Talent Acquisition and HR Business Partners. Provide best in class expertise and advice in partnership with hiring managers to provide a superior candidate experience, to secure the best talent quickly using effective and efficient workflow management. Be viewed as a trusted talent advisor and share market insights and intelligence as gathered from candidate interactions.

Where external recruitment is required, source, screen, assess talent and make recommendations to managers on candidates, develop a solid understanding of assigned business and build strong relationships with managers, HR partners and other internal groups as appropriate, partner with managers to facilitate employment offer process and provides meaningful feedback to internal and external candidates, ensuring candidate experience is extremely positive, client (Hiring Manager) experience is professional and commercial, and work with Head of HR, Business Leaders, and Senior Manager, Talent Acquisition to ensure reporting on Talent Acquisition (TA) activities are accurate and timely.

Job Description

What will you do?

  • Effectively manage the recruitment process for roles assigned, across Line of Businesses / Business Platforms.
  • Effectively collaborate with hiring managers to plan & deliver talent acquisition plans, while building a strong reputation / relationship with hiring managers
  • Build a strong understanding of the recruitment process, various milestones along the way, and be proactive and resourceful to overcome challenges throughout the process. Ensure required routines are in place to meet business needs.
  • Create plan and lead the hiring strategy conversation, acting in an advisory role to hiring managers during the intake & overall recruitment process
  • Build and maintain a pipeline of candidates for recurring and hard-to-fill roles through appropriate and targeted sourcing including good quality market intelligence to business head regarding the recruitment market
  • Ensure high compliant to the end-to-end recruitment process from sourcing, interview, offer to on-boarding.
  • Data Integrity : Regularly update Workday as per specified data integrity process requirements (i.e. ensure data is included when a hire is made, appropriate movement of candidates through folders, etc.)
  • Develop and maintain positive working relationships with all the recruitment and HR team members as well as candidates and hiring managers.
  • Deliver a superior recruitment experience to all candidates and hiring managers
  • Strong understanding of RBC’s value proposition to appropriately “sell” career opportunities
  • Demonstrate commitment to continuous learning by building business acumen, sharing competitive intelligence, and staying abreast of business / market trends
  • Representing the function of TA effectively throughout RBC and externally ensuring our brand is protected and profiled in interactions
